But, it would be nice if somebody on the bridge said their was a ping and at what bearing.
I hope nobody on the bridge is telling you anything - they'd be busy drowning. Remember - on a Sub, the bridge is only manned while on the surface. I think you meant Control instead.

Seriously, I agree with the message list. Even apart from the list of bearings and such for the initial contact, keeping up with other messages that come in while I'm busy steering the boat for the OOD, DIVE, and Helmsman/Planesman can be... challenging. The ability to go back through the list would be invaluable.
